Noticed that the ppm had shot up to 750. Checked the tapwater and rainwater inputs, and the tapwater has significantly increased its ppm (from about 300 to about 450). Unsure what the water company are doing... they are a bunch of profiteering gangsters and I do not trust them at all. There's been heavy rain here lately, which might be related. The base mix I've been using is 40% tapwater amended with nitric acid, to 60% rainwater, but I might tweak that now and check pH again.
 

aliceklar

Active member
Halved the amount of tapwater in the mix and the ppm reduced to about 550. That seems better. pH 5.9, a little high but acceptable. Will keep a close eye on it. Growth overall looks paler than I'd like to see, and some older leaves have interveinal yellowing, but I'm more concerned with over than with under feeding. All still growing rapidly. Have started removing some of the lower leaves & straggly lower shoots.

Quite a few showing sex now. Lemon Candy 2 and 6 are male, #4 is female. Of the Thais, p2 #6 and p2 #5 are male, and P1 #4 definitely female. Where males are showing, I'm pruning off everything apart from a single decent flowering branch from that graft (or rootstock) - the remaining girls can fill the gaps. Ethiopian is on the cusp. Think it might be male... in which case I'll freeze some pollen for next time, and use fresh pollen to make some Johaar & Thai pure sativa hybrids. Will know for sure in a day or two.

Everything seems to be drinking heavily now - am needing to water a lot more to get any run-off.
